  • Deckhand

    Kenai Fjords Tours

    Safety, anticipating guest needs, honoring our surroundings and bringing your best every day are the core values we live by in order to provide dynamic guest service at Kenai Fjords Tours. You will interact with the guests with the goal of ensuring their safety and providing excellent service for an unforgettable and memorable experience. You will be knowledgeable with the safety equipment and procedures on board, including participating in all safety drills and reviews. You will have a range of duties and responsibilities to include:

    • Learn and perform safe line handling skills under direction of the Captain, Sr Deckhand or Crew Chief
    • Exhibit knowledge of local history, geology and industry
    • Regularly interact with guests regarding safety procedures, tour information, boat information and environmental data
    • Conduct food services, including cooking, preparation, serving and cleaning up
    • Strive to ensure guest’s expectations are exceeded

  • CDL Shuttle Driver

    Kenai Fjords Tours
    $23.00 / hour

    / $1000.00 sign on bonus for CDL drivers, $500.00 non-CDL

    Uses company transportation assets to move guests and cargo in a safe, friendly and timely manner.
    Drivers conduct and coordinate basic maintenance on company vehicles and maintain records in
    accordance with U.S. Department of Transportation and company standards

    • Conduct pre and post operation maintenance on assigned vehicle daily. Annotate issues correctly
    • Operate shuttles along assigned routes, reporting changes or challenges to the coordinator
    • Coordinate and communicate with guest service, group coordination and marine staffs to ensure that
      guests receive the best possible service and important information is shared throughout the company
    • Maintains records in accordance with company, state and DOT requirements regarding vehicle
      maintenance, driver activities and traffic incidents
